Specialized exercise equipment designed to target gluteal muscles exists in various forms, offering resistance through stacks of weight plates, levers, or other mechanisms. Examples include hip thrust machines, glute kickbacks, and abduction/adduction equipment. These machines provide controlled movements and isolate specific muscle groups for effective strengthening and development.

Strengthening these muscles contributes significantly to improved athletic performance, including running, jumping, and squatting. It also plays a vital role in injury prevention, particularly in the lower back and knees, by promoting stability and proper alignment. Historically, focused glute training was often overlooked in favor of other muscle groups, but the recognition of its importance in overall physical well-being has led to a surge in specialized equipment and training methodologies.

1. Targeted Muscle Engagement

Targeted muscle engagement is paramount for maximizing the effectiveness of glute-focused training. Weight machines offer a distinct advantage in this regard by providing controlled movement patterns and isolating the gluteal muscles. This isolation minimizes the recruitment of secondary muscle groups, such as the hamstrings and quadriceps, allowing for concentrated work on the glutes. The controlled environment of machines also facilitates proper form, which is crucial for effective muscle activation. For instance, a hip abduction machine stabilizes the body, allowing for focused contraction of the gluteus medius and minimus, muscles often undertrained with free weights.

This focused engagement enhances hypertrophy and strength development within the glutes. By minimizing compensatory movements, individuals can ensure the target muscles are subjected to the intended stimulus. This principle is especially relevant for individuals recovering from injuries or those new to strength training, as machines provide a safer and more controlled environment for building a solid foundation. The ability to isolate specific gluteal muscles also allows for addressing imbalances and sculpting a balanced physique, promoting both aesthetic and functional benefits.

2. Resistance and Progression

Resistance and progression are fundamental principles for muscle growth and strength development, particularly relevant when utilizing weight machines for glute training. Progressive overload, achieved by systematically increasing the resistance applied to the muscles, stimulates hypertrophy and strength gains. This principle is effectively implemented through weight machines, offering precise and incremental adjustments in resistance levels.

  • Incremental Weight Adjustments

    Weight machines provide a controlled environment for incremental weight adjustments, allowing for precise increases in resistance as strength improves. This precision is crucial for optimizing training stimulus and avoiding plateaus. For example, a hip thrust machine allows users to add small weight plates incrementally, ensuring progressive overload and continuous gains. This precise control also minimizes the risk of injury associated with large jumps in weight common with free weights.

  • Variable Resistance Mechanisms

    Certain weight machines employ variable resistance mechanisms that alter the resistance throughout the range of motion. This design accommodates the natural strength curve of the muscles, providing increased resistance where muscles are strongest and reduced resistance where they are weaker. This optimized resistance profile maximizes muscle activation and promotes more uniform strength development across the entire range of motion.

  • Progression Tracking and Measurement

    The structured nature of weight machines facilitates accurate tracking and measurement of progress. The clear increments in weight allow for objective assessment of strength gains over time, motivating continued adherence to the training program. This precise tracking allows for data-driven adjustments to the training program, ensuring continued progression and minimizing the risk of plateaus.

  • Adaptability for Different Fitness Levels

    Weight machines offer a wide range of resistance options, accommodating individuals of all fitness levels. This adaptability makes them an ideal choice for both beginners starting with lighter weights and experienced lifters seeking to challenge themselves with heavier loads. The controlled environment and precise adjustments allow for safe and effective progression, regardless of starting strength.

3. Proper Form and Technique

Proper form and technique are paramount for maximizing the effectiveness and safety of glute training with weight machines. Correct execution ensures optimal muscle activation and minimizes the risk of injury. The guided movements offered by machines can facilitate proper form, particularly for individuals new to strength training. However, simply using a machine does not guarantee correct technique. Careful attention must be paid to body positioning, range of motion, and controlled movements.

For example, during a hip thrust on a dedicated machine, maintaining a neutral spine and avoiding hyperextension of the lower back is crucial for targeting the glutes effectively and preventing lower back strain. Similarly, when using a glute kickback machine, controlling the movement and avoiding excessive momentum ensures isolated glute activation and reduces the risk of hamstring or lower back injuries. Understanding the correct execution for each exercise, including foot placement, grip, and breathing patterns, significantly influences results. Consulting with a qualified fitness professional can provide personalized guidance on proper form and technique, tailored to individual needs and anatomical variations. Visual aids, such as instructional videos and anatomical diagrams, can further enhance understanding and promote correct execution.

Neglecting proper form and technique can negate the benefits of weight machines and increase the risk of injuries. Compromised form can shift the workload to unintended muscle groups, reducing glute activation and potentially straining supporting structures. Consistent practice of correct technique is essential for maximizing muscle development, preventing injuries, and achieving desired fitness outcomes. Question 1: Are weight machines more effective than bodyweight exercises for glute development?

While bodyweight exercises can be effective for building a foundation, weight machines offer the advantage of progressive overload through quantifiable resistance increments, leading to greater hypertrophy and strength gains over time.

Question 2: Can weight machines isolate the glutes effectively?

Weight machines offer a controlled environment that facilitates isolation of the gluteal muscles, minimizing the recruitment of secondary muscle groups and promoting targeted muscle development.

Question 3: What are the primary safety considerations when using weight machines for glute training?

Maintaining proper form and technique is crucial for injury prevention. Ensuring correct body positioning, controlled movements, and adherence to recommended resistance levels minimizes the risk of strain or injury.

Question 4: How frequently should one incorporate weight machine glute exercises into a training routine?

Training frequency depends on individual fitness levels and program design. Generally, allowing 48-72 hours of recovery between glute-focused workouts is recommended to allow for muscle repair and growth.

Question 5: Can weight machines be used for both glute hypertrophy and strength development?

Yes, weight machines can be utilized for both hypertrophy and strength development by adjusting the resistance levels and repetition ranges. Higher repetitions with moderate weight target hypertrophy, while lower repetitions with heavier weight emphasize strength gains.

Question 6: Are there specific weight machines recommended for targeting different gluteal muscles?

Specific machines target different gluteal muscles. Hip thrust machines primarily focus on the gluteus maximus, while abduction/adduction machines target the gluteus medius and minimus. Understanding the function of each machine allows for a comprehensive glute training approach.

Effective Glute Training Tips Using Weight Machines

Optimizing glute training outcomes requires a strategic approach encompassing proper machine selection, exercise execution, and program design. These tips offer practical guidance for maximizing the benefits of weight machines in glute-focused workouts.

Tip 1: Prioritize Proper Form
Maintaining correct posture and controlled movements throughout each exercise is paramount. Prioritizing form ensures targeted muscle activation and minimizes the risk of injury.

Tip 2: Progressive Overload is Key
Systematically increasing resistance, either by adding weight or increasing lever arm difficulty, stimulates muscle growth and strength development. Consistent progression prevents plateaus and maximizes long-term results.

Tip 3: Utilize a Variety of Machines
Incorporating different machines targets various aspects of glute development. Hip thrust machines emphasize the gluteus maximus, while abduction/adduction machines focus on the gluteus medius and minimus. This variety promotes balanced muscle development.

Tip 4: Control the Tempo
Controlled, deliberate movements maximize muscle engagement and time under tension, promoting hypertrophy. Avoid using momentum to complete repetitions.

Tip 5: Focus on the Mind-Muscle Connection
Concentrating on the targeted muscle group during each exercise enhances muscle fiber recruitment and improves overall effectiveness. Visualizing the muscle working promotes optimal activation.

Tip 6: Warm-up Adequately
Preparing the muscles for exercise through a dynamic warm-up improves performance and reduces the risk of injury. Incorporating movements that activate the glutes, such as hip circles and glute bridges, enhances readiness for subsequent exercises.

Tip 7: Allow for Adequate Recovery
Sufficient rest between sets and workouts facilitates muscle repair and growth. Overtraining can hinder progress and increase the risk of injury.
